2003 S500 Engine Noise

I bought a mint 2003 Mercedes S500 a month ago with a loud "ticking" noise. I bought it at a salvage price because of the noise. It has 130,000 miles. I took it to my 30+ year
experienced MB mechanic. He said he has checked the car throughly, and the noise has to be a lifter. It idles perfectly & drives likewise. He said the engine inside was one of the
cleanest he has seen. He wants me to drive the car on a long trip with Marvel Mystery Oil. He feels it stop the noise. My question is why would there be lifter noise with the engine
being so clean? Also, any recommended oil additives that have proven to work? Any insights
appreciated!

Every M112 and M113 is susceptible to this failure because Mercedes in their infinite wisdom decided NOT to include an oil pressure gauge or even an oil pressure idiot light on these engines. As a driver you have no way of knowing if you have an oil pressure problem until it's too late. Have the mechanic test oil pressure or install an oil pressure gauge.
